Two-team race for Sundin?

Posted: Thursday July 24, 2008 07:20AM ET

Mike Gillis figures it's now a two-team race and the Vancouver Canuck general manager still believes he has more than a decent chance of landing free-agent centre Mats Sundin. Gillis has not had any recent discussions with Sundin, but read his comments that were published in a Swedish daily on Monday. "What I took from it was that it sounds like he is considering two teams, Toronto and us," Gillis said in an interview Tuesday.
